Identifying the Locations of the Fuse Panels
The primary location for the electrical control system is inside the cabin, near the driver’s side. This area usually contains multiple circuits for internal systems like lighting, air conditioning, and audio equipment. To access this panel, look beneath the dashboard, either near the driver’s left knee or directly under the steering wheel.
Another key area for electrical management is under the hood, near the engine bay. This section handles high-power systems, including the engine, alternator, and starter motor. The panel in this area is typically situated near the battery or close to the fender, depending on the vehicle design.
If you are troubleshooting or performing maintenance, make sure to inspect both panels. Some systems might be split between the two, meaning one component could be controlled by a relay in the cabin, while the power feed may come from the under-hood panel.
For easy access, check for covers that need to be removed. These covers are usually secured with clips or bolts, so having the right tools on hand is crucial. If the covers are difficult to remove, consider consulting your vehicle’s manual for specific instructions on how to handle them safely.
Keep in mind that some models also have secondary panels located in the trunk or behind specific interior panels. These are typically used for non-essential features like the rear windows or seat adjustments. Refer to the owner’s manual for exact locations if you’re having trouble locating them.
Finally, always remember to disconnect the battery before working on these panels to avoid any electrical hazards. If you notice any damaged or frayed wiring, replace it immediately to prevent further electrical issues from occurring.
